Being restored by Members AD Durnin & Maria Doyle, CRL 810 spent nearly 40 years languishing in a barn

Maria & I bought the car in 2006 and started the long and winding road of bringing the car back to its former glory.

I already owned a couple of 'Modern' Triumphs and after coming away from a VSCC meeting at Mallory Park, the idea of a vintage car restoration took hold. But it had to be large enough for the whole family.
As luck would have it Ebay turn up this car a couple of weeks later and Maria and I were hooked.

CRL810 had stood for nearly forty years in a barn in Warwickshire and was in a very bad state of repair. We both joined the club in 2006 and after answering our Editor's request for new blood on the committee, I volunteered my services at the 2007 AGM and was duly elected.

As I had previous experience of computer programming, I was asked to update the Club Website.

The restoration of CRL 810 is progressing, but we are under no illusions of how long this will take. However with all the friends and support that we have found through the Club, we are sure it will be made a little easier.
